Why be a Country Manager at THG?
At Myprotein, being a Country Manager means leading one of the world’s largest online sports nutrition brands within a fast-paced, innovative ecommerce ecosystem. You will own and drive the overall strategy and performance for the Danish market, with full accountability for trading, growth, and brand presence.
Working closely with senior leadership, you’ll shape the market strategy, leverage advanced tools and insights, and collaborate cross-functionally to deliver best-in-class results. This role offers strong ownership, visibility, and clear progression opportunities within a global, high-growth business.
As a Country Manager, you will:
- Take full ownership of the Myprotein Denmark ecommerce business, including P&L, sales performance, and strategic growth
- Define and execute the ecommerce and trading strategy for the Danish market
- Monitor and optimise key site metrics including GP, Conversion Rate, Bounce Rate, AOV, Exit Rates, and Traffic (new vs returning)
- Use analytics and in-house reporting tools to understand customer behaviour, optimise the user journey, and drive performance
- Lead and implement the influencer marketing strategy for Norway, including ownership and expansion of the influencer database
- Drive brand awareness through localised campaigns, partnerships, and creative initiatives
- Collaborate with central digital marketing teams to identify new opportunities to grow traffic and improve performance across all channels
- Identify and execute innovative strategies to acquire new customers and retain existing ones
- Oversee pricing, promotions, and commercial planning to ensure profitability and achievement of GP targets
- Own CRM strategy and lifecycle marketing initiatives to grow and engage the Danish customer base
- Align monthly and quarterly commercial targets with trading plans and campaign activity
- Ensure best-in-class website merchandising, including optimisation of banners, landing pages, category pages, and product pages
- Work cross-functionally with design, content, and product teams to deliver a high-quality, localised customer experience
- Identify new growth opportunities and continuously improve brand positioning and market share in Denmark
What skills and experience do I need for this role?
- Fluent Danish and English (written and spoken)
- Proven experience in ecommerce, digital marketing, or online trading—ideally with ownership of a market or P&L
-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ret data and translate insights into action
- Commercial mindset with experience managing pricing, promotions, and revenue growth
- Excellent collaboration and stakeholder management skills
- Highly results-driven, proactive, and comfortable working in a fast-paced environment
- Experience with influencer marketing and CRM strategies is advantageous
- Knowledge of the nutrition, fitness, or wellness industry is a plus
